Transaction 53e161c15e8b7aa7a414c29da580d9ba422610c1fe981b77b41df11a9eaee1ae

1 Input
2 Outputs
  • 53e161c15e8b7aa7a414c29da580d9ba422610c1fe981b77b41df11a9eaee1ae:0
  • value  100000
    address  3M82b7Vi39uRMBgSM3rnqbRAU22HVzzEnh
  • 53e161c15e8b7aa7a414c29da580d9ba422610c1fe981b77b41df11a9eaee1ae:1
  • value  148974275
    address  35WtbUPBbxDdbUdidJo5sy433YS6k6dH5u